Jollywood Nights 2023 DATES AND INFO
Disney Jollywood Nights is a separately ticketed event from 8:30 p.m.-12:30 a.m. on select nights Nov. 11-Dec. 20, 2023. This new glitzy Christmas party boasts entertainment offerings and experiences especially geared toward adults.
There are going to be multiple cocktail parties, specialty drinks and food, live entertainment, special character greetings, exclusive shows, and after-hours access to the most popular thrill rides at Disney's Hollywood Studios.

Tickets may be purchased by all guests starting July 6 on the Walt Disney World website. Ticket prices will range from $159 – $179 per person.
What rides are open during Jollywood Nights?
The most thrilling rides of Disney's Hollywood Studios are open during Jollywood Nights.
After-hours access includes:
- Slinky Dog Dash
- Rock N’ Roller Coaster Starring Aerosmith
- The Twilight Zone Tower of Terror
- Star Wars: Rise of the Resistance*
- and more….
Star Wars: Rise of Resistance will use virtual queue* during Disney Jollywood Nights.

Jollywood Night Shows
- Kermit the Frog and Miss Piggy will be very special guests at Theater of the Stars along with some of their Disney friends including Princess Tiana and Belle singing “As Long as There’s Christmas.”
- “What’s This: Tim Burton’s Nightmare Before Christmas Sing-along” will transform the Hyperion Theater into a twistedly festive sing-along featuring “What’s This” and “Kidnapping Sandy Claus” songs.
- “Jingle Bell, Jingle BAM!” is the party’s finale jam-packed with music, fireworks, special effects and dazzling state-of-the-art projections.

Disney Jollywood Nights Zones
- As you enter the party a DJ spinning a mix of holiday tunes welcomes you.
- Commissary Lane comes to life with a lively Latin Street Fair.
- Echo Lake will be home to Powerline Max (Goofy’s son), as well as Chip and Dale Rescue Rangers, and Phineas and Ferb (!!!)
- Two limited-capacity entertainment experiences – a jazz lounge at The Hollywood Brown Derby and an other-worldly soiree at The Hollywood Tower Hotel Courtyard.
- Meet Mickey Mouse, Minnie Mouse and the rest of the iconic gang in Animation Courtyard on a hot set with holiday props.
- Frozone from The Incredibles makes a frosty environment along Pixar Place

Get there early
There is no official word on this just yet, but ticketholders to Mickey's Very Merry Christmas Party can enter Magic Kingdom at 4pm, that's 3 hours before the official party start time. It stands to reason that Disney Jollywood Nights would offer something similar.
And even if you cannot enter Disney's Hollywood Studios until the party official starts at 8pm, it's a good idea to arrive at the parking lot by 7:00 pm so you have time to get through security and be there as the park opens to party goers.
With only four hours of party time, getting there early is key to making the most of it.

Budget $40 – $50 per person on food and beverage
Every special event at Disney World offers exclusive food and drinks. Disney Jollywood Nights looks to have a number of specialty Christmas cocktails as well as festive food.

So far we know there will be Spicy Korean Chicken on a Mini Funnel Cake, sweet delights including a colorful Christmas Tree Cookie Stack inspired by the iconic Echo Lake Christmas Tree, and classic cocktails and holiday beverages.
Usually, such specialty food runs about $7 – $9 per item and drinks are about $9 – $14.
Stay as late as possible
The evening ends with a spectacular. “Jingle Bell, Jingle BAM!” is the party’s finale jam-packed with music, fireworks, special effects, and dazzling state-of-the-art projections.
This nighttime show and finale takes place near the center of the park. And once it is done you can bet there will be a massive amount of people heading for the park exit. If you're not among the first ones out of the park, you're in for a long wait for transportation or to leave the parking lot.
So stick around and enjoy some moments in the park while everyone else rushes out. Find a bench and sit for a while. Soak up the festive music and savor the memories you've made.
